You can notify this IRS over a name-change letter if the change needs to be much or if you’ve never filed an INCOME return for the business. http://panonclearance.com/corporate-election-irs-form-c-corp-s-corp-forms WebNov 23, 2024 · LLC tax preparation involves different tax rules and forms, depending on the business's tax status. LLCs may be taxed like sole proprietorships, partnerships, or corporations.
